Hi,

I have been using displayfusion with Windows 7 without any issues - having dual screens and using the screensaver to show pictures from different locations on different screens. However I have now upgraded to Windows 10 and although DisplayFusion loads on start-up (icon appears on the right of the taskbar) the screensaver will not work unless I open settings within DisplayFusion then 'Save' and 'Apply' before the screensaver will work. I have to then repeat the process every time I boot my computer.

I'm currently using DisplayFusion Pro V7.2

Before fixing the screen saver after a reboot, if you just right-click the DisplayFusion tray icon and navigate to Screen Saver > Start Screen Saver, does it start correctly?

When I right click on the icon in the system tray and select 'Start Screensaver' as suggested the screensaver does start, however once the mouse is moved and the screensaver disappears I then wait for the 1 minute before it should kick back in automatically and nothing happens.

Ok, it sounds like something is preventing Windows from going into idle mode. Could you do the following?
  • Open an elevated command prompt
  • Enter the following command: powercfg /requests > %USERPROFILE%\Desktop\powercfgrequests.txt
  • Reply with the "powercfgrequests.txt" file attached (you'll find it on your desktop)
